地域对数据库访问影响分析 (不同地区访问数据库)

随着互联网的不断发展,数据库已经成为了信息化建设的一个重要组成部分,数据库的应用范围也在不断扩大,涉及到的领域也越来越广泛。但是在实际的应用中,我们发现地域对数据库的访问有一定的影响,这种影响主要表现在两个方面:一是网络因素对访问速度的影响,二是地域对数据库服务商的选择的影响。本文将从这两个方面对地域对数据库访问的影响进行分析。

网络因素对访问速度的影响

我们需要了解网络对数据库访问的影响。随着互联网的发展,在全球范围内建立了许多的数据中心,这些数据中心可以提供访问全球数据的服务。但是由于网络带宽和延迟等网络因素的存在,不同地域的用户访问同一个数据中心时,速度还是存在差异的。

网络带宽是指单位时间内可传输的数据量,它对访问速度的影响程度相对较小,因为随着网络设备的升级,带宽的提升已经不再是瓶颈。网络延迟是指从客户端发送请求到服务器响应的时间,这个时间较长时,会因等待而导致访问速度的下降。而网络延迟与用户的地理位置有关,距离远的用户相对于距离近的用户,访问速度就会更慢。

但是网络延迟不是影响访问速度的唯一因素,还有交换机和路由器之间的转发的时间以及服务器处理请求的时间也会影响访问的速度。交换机和路由器之间的转发时间是指中转时间,也即数据从一个网络设备传输到另一个网络设备所需要的时间,在路由器单向转发延迟较短,而中转设备较多的情况下,中转延迟较长。服务器处理请求的时间也是影响访问速度的因素之一,它依赖于服务器负载、性能等因素。

地域对数据库服务商的选择的影响

除了网络因素对访问速度的影响,地域还对数据库服务商的选择有一定的影响。不同地区的数据中心锁提供的服务质量和价格是不同的。在国外,大部分的数据服务商都是美国的,而在国内,也有些大的云服务厂商如阿里云、华为云和腾讯云等。但是在选择时,我们需要考虑本地管理员的技术水平、用户隐私保护以及数据安全等问题。在国外使用国外云的好处是在可用性和可靠性方面表现的更出色。但是,大部分的国外数据中心对国内用户速度不够理想,在访问速度方面有一定的限制。

在国内,由于涉及政策限制,访问国外数据中心的速度较慢,一般情况下只有20~30Mbps的速度限制,而访问国内数据中心的速度可以达到百兆级别。因此,对于大部分国内的应用,选择国内的云服务商进行数据管理是非常合适的。

结论

综上所述,地域对数据库访问有一定的影响。一方面是网络因素,网络带宽和延迟等网络因素会影响访问速度;另一方面是地域对数据库服务商的选择,选择合适的服务商可以在保证能力的同时,保证访问速度。因此,在使用数据库时,我们需要充分考虑这些因素,并根据实际情况进行选择。

相关问题拓展阅读:

mysql 数据库 和 网站 可以放在不同服务器上吗?

可以这样,但是会影响访问速度,之前我也这么尝试过,MYSQL数据在国内,空间在国外,访问速度差异特别明显,不论国内还是国外都一样,同样,我也测试过,国内空间和数据库,空间在上海,数瞎卖据库在北京,访问速度依然受限,这个问题很简单,各个地方的磨咐逗网络联通情况不同,地区间的传输速率会收到地形,以及当地网络状况的影响。分开使用的话,不管哪一方出现网络延迟,结果都是网络访问速度慢。影响你的使用效果。同样维护也麻烦,建议你,使用同一台服务器。那样速度基本不会太受影响。目前空间简闭,一般都是空间和数据库在同一台机器上。一是访问速度能够保证,此外就是维护方便。祝你好运。

1,可以。 2,没什么优缺点,皮御芹但不燃毕在同一服务器可以分担负载。3,速度相对当然慢点。 3,一般情况下在同拆滑一台服务器。

PHP 根据IP获取地区查询数据库内容

有可配碧扰能你查询出来的是很多条记录。

而你在$rs=mysql_fetch_array($q);的使用上可能还有不熟悉的地方。你打印出来培旦看看具体是慧扮什么。

select * from tab2 where city=city1

关于不同地区访问数据库的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 地域对数据库访问影响分析 (不同地区访问数据库)